Crinklechips Never more his father's son than on this release. This is an album full of political musings and a big atheistic anthem near the end. I think it's safe to say you wont enjoy this album unless you lean to the left, even if only slightly.

Nick is joined by Port Erin on this offering, another excellent local (to me) band that I highly recommend.

It's more caustic than his usual output. I like it a lot. It's like a continuation of the dark half of Riven.

Favorite track: Have A Nice Deity.
